The following substances can soften rubber:

  1. Kerosene. Allows you to make rubber parts soft by affecting the structure of the material. After processing, the rubber element is fully elastic. The recovery technology is as follows:
  • fill a small container with kerosene (choose the size of the container depending on the size of the product to be restored);
  • place the part in a container with kerosene for 3 hours;
  • after the specified time, check the product for softness, if the result is satisfactory: remove the material and rinse with warm running water;
  • dry the material in a natural way, without using a hair dryer or battery.
  1. Ammonium alcohol. The process of restoring old material is as follows:
  • dilute the indicated alcohol with water in a ratio of 1: 7;
  • place the rubber material in the resulting solution for half an hour;
  • after the specified time, remove the part and rinse with warm running water;
  • let the parts dry completely before using.

Please note: you cannot keep rubber in a solution of ammonia and water for more than an hour. If the material does not become elastic after 30 minutes, use a different recovery method.

  1. Rubbing alcohol followed by glycerin. Reanimation technology for rubber parts:
  • fill the container with medical alcohol;
  • place in alcohol the part that needs restoration for several hours;
  • after the specified time has passed, check the condition of the product, if it is soft enough, remove the element from the solution and wash it with warm soapy water;
  • rub glycerin into the surface of the part using a sponge (cloth);
  • remove the remains of glycerin from the surface of the product.

Instead of glycerin, it is allowed to use automotive oil, it is rubbed into the surface of the product, then the parts are kept for half an hour before use. During this period, the rubber becomes sufficiently elastic.

  1. Castor oil and silicone. Let's make a reservation right away - this method allows you to quickly "reanimate" old rubber, but the recovery effect will not last long, after a few days the product will become hard. For this method, follow the sequence:
  • smear the part with silicone;
  • wait 10 minutes;
  • after the specified time, the part can be used.

Note that a similar effect is achieved with castor oil. It is rubbed into the surface of the part, after which it becomes soft and elastic.

Heating is an effective method

Container with prepared water for boiling rubber products

There are situations when the rubber element, due to its hardening, is difficult to remove from structural parts. To achieve the desired result, you can heat the rubber with a stream of hot air using a hair dryer. When exposed to high temperature, the material will become softer, it will be possible to pull it off the part.

Too "hardened" element is softened by boiling in salted water. The technology is as follows:

  • fill the container with salted water;
  • let the liquid boil;
  • place the rubber element in boiling water for 10 minutes;
  • remove the rubber and quickly use it for its intended purpose.

This method is quite effective, but has a short-term effect. Cooling down, the rubber will become hard again.

Varieties of lubricants

Asking the question of how to lubricate the rubber bands, you need to have an idea of \u200b\u200bhow what types of lubricants are available to motorists today and what are the advantages and disadvantages of each type. This should be discussed in more detail.


Paste products

These are thick plastic mixtures applied with napkins. Paste-like means are used when processing automotive rubber seals, equipment for diving and home appliances. The disadvantages of such lubricants include the difficulty of lubricating hard-to-reach places.

Gel products

This type of grease has a thick or liquid consistency and is applied to the parts with a soft cloth. The advantages of thick funds include the fact that parts that are not processed remain clean... While their disadvantage is the impossibility of applying in hard-to-reach places. Liquid gel products are used to treat complex devices, since they, on the contrary, easily penetrate into hard-to-reach places. The disadvantage of liquid gel products is their ability to spread, but sometimes, this becomes their clear advantage.

Aerosol products

These tools are easy to use. They are used to apply on large surfaces and small parts in hard-to-reach areas. The disadvantage of aerosols is excessive splashing.leading to contamination of neighboring elements. To reduce splashing, use special long nozzles. In addition, aerosol products will form grease stains if rubbed insufficiently.

Composition and function of the substance

Lubricating silicone for cars in the form of an aerosol or gel is an artificial substance developed on the basis of organic and inorganic materials. The base of the product is silicone oil or lithium grease and other elements such as hydrocarbon solvent, propellant, etc. Thickeners may be used in the grease.

What are the requirements for the substance:

  • must be compatible with the material of which the sealing elements are made, as well as the adjacent spare parts;
  • product performance is maintained over a wide temperature range;
  • the substance must reliably protect the rubberized elements from rapid wear and tear and cracking;
  • processing parts with lubricant should lead to a decrease in friction;
  • one of the main requirements - the product must provide a separation effect, that is, after using it, the parts must not stick to each other;
  • when processing seals, the substance should increase the tightness of the connection;
  • the product must be resistant to water so that it does not wash off the substance as a result of contact with lubricated parts.

The main functions of the substance:

  1. Restorative. The use of the substance must ensure the preservation of the elasticity of the treated elements. If parts begin to soften during operation, the product must quickly restore the elasticity, functionality and appearance of the seals.
  2. Insulating. The grease protects the rubber elements from water.
  3. Lubricating. The treatment of parts with a substance allows the sealing elements to better adhere to various surfaces.
  4. Protective. It consists in ensuring the durability of the service life of the parts. The lubricant must not only prevent the seals from being exposed to water, but also prevent corrosion on metal components. High-quality lubricants prevent dust and dirt from getting inside the structure.

How and with what to wash silicone grease?

To answer this question, you need to familiarize yourself with the composition of the product. If the lubricant accidentally spills on clothing or glass, do not try to wipe it off immediately. This will lead to the fact that the greasy stain on the surface will only increase. Depending on the composition of the substance, a solvent is selected that will help remove unwanted traces of liquid.

How can traces of silicone rubber seal be removed:

  1. If the main element in the base of the substance is acid, then vinegar (70% solution) is required to neutralize traces. A clean cloth is moistened with vinegar, with which the contaminated surface is subsequently treated. After processing, you must wait at least half an hour. Then the acetic acid is wiped off with a rag.
  2. If the product is alcohol based, an alcohol solution will be required to remove any traces of grease. It can be purchased at the pharmacy. It is allowed to use technical or denatured alcohol. In its absence, you can use vodka. Soak a rag in the solution, then wipe the surface with it until the hardened silicone is removed.
  3. The base of the substance can be oximes, amides and amines. In such cases, gasoline, any alcohol-based solvents or white spirit can be used to remove traces of contamination. To remove the silicone, the place is processed, after which you have to wait half an hour. If you could not remove the dirt the first time, then repeat the procedure.

You can learn more about removing silicone from various surfaces, as well as clothes, from the video filmed by the Miss Clean channel.

If you are removing the grease with vinegar or acetone, wear rubber gloves. The use of acetone is not always allowed, it all depends on the composition. Be careful as this product can damage the paintwork on the car body. In some cases, glass cleaner and ammonia can effectively remove traces of silicone grease.
